1:更新系统
sudo apt-get update
2:安装相关软件
sudo apt-get install vim openssl build-essential libssl-dev wget crul git
3:下载nvm(用于升级和管理nodejs)
wget -qO- https://raw.githubusercontent.com/creationix/nvm/v0.33.2/install.sh | bash
4:新打开一个命令行窗口,测试是否安装成功
nvm
5:安装最新的nodejs
nvm install v6.11.2
6:指定使用版本node版本,并设置为默认使用
nvm use v6.11.2
nvm alias default v6.11.2
7:查看node版本(至此node安装成功)
node -v
8:安装nodejs包管理工具npm(为了不用下载太慢,使用淘宝源)
npm --registry=https://registry.npm.taobao.org install -g npm
9:测试npm是否安装成功
npm -v
10:增加系统的文件监控数目:
echo fs.inotify.max_user_watches=524288 | sudo tee -a /etc/sysctl.conf && sudo sysctl -p
11.安装cnpm(淘宝源,比npm要快一点点)
npm --registry=https://registry.npm.taobao.org install -g cnpm
12:全局安装工具包(花费时间可能较长,请耐心等待,如果由于网速原因安装失败,可以通过cnpm进行安装,具体操作见13)
npm i pm2 webpack gulp grunt-cli -g
13:cnpm全局安装:
npm install -g cnpm --registry=https://registry.npm.taobao.org
安装工具包
cnpm i pm2 webpack gulp grunt-cli -g

最新文章

  1. console的花式用法
  2. 工作总结_sql
  3. springmvc对同名参数处理-我们到底能走多远系列(44)
  4. JSP内置对象有哪些呢?
  5. select resharper shortcuts scheme
  6. .atomic vs volatile
  7. jquery - ul li click 无响应
  8. JavaScript高级程序设计2.pdf
  9. bst 二叉搜索树简单实现
  10. 【深入浅出jQuery】源码浅析--整体架构(转)
  11. 【转】pyhton之Reportlab模块——生成pdf文件
  12. CodeForces 464E The Classic Problem | 呆克斯歘 主席树维护高精度
  13. 跟我一起学习vue2(使用命令行搭建单页应用)[二]
  14. 快速排序partition过程常见的两种写法+快速排序非递归实现
  15. 【转】Linux 高级的视角来查看Linux引导过程
  16. CAS (6) —— Nginx代理模式下浏览器访问CAS服务器网络顺序图详解
  17. php CI框架实现验证码功能和增强验证码安全性实战教程
  18. 如何查看你的 FastAdmin 服务器是否开启了 gzip br 压缩
  19. ESXI5.5开启snmp+zabbix 监控esxi 需要开启的服务
  20. Atom | 编辑器Atom的使用小结

热门文章

  1. .net core获取服务器本地IP及Request访问端口
  2. asp.net MVC 统计在线人数功能实现
  3. 将GridView的数据导出Excel
  4. C#MVC和cropper.js实现剪裁图片ajax上传的弹出层
  5. Web Server IIS7部署网站常遇到的错误及解决办法
  6. Day37 多进程
  7. Ceres入门笔记
  8. RabbitMQ Java实例
  9. Storm Trident状态
  10. iOS多线程---NSOperation介绍和使用